Dead as a doornail. (simile) Unquestionably dead. Used for both inanimate objects and once living beings. I picked up the phone, but the line was dead as a The usual reason given is that a doornail was one of the heavy studded nails on the outside of a medieval door, or possibly that the phrase refers to the particularly big one on which the knocker rested. A doornail, because of its size and probable antiquity, would seem dead enough for any proverb; the one on which the knocker sat might be Adjective. dead as a doornail. (simile) Unquestionably dead. Definitions by the largest Idiom Dictionary Langland also used the expression in the much more famous poem The vision of William concerning Piers Plowman, Fey withouten fait is febelore þen nouȝt, And ded as a dore-nayl. [Faith without works is feebler than nothing, and dead as a [HOST] expression was in widespread colloquial use in England by the 16th century, when Definition: To be completely, irretrievably dead, or for an inanimate object; completely useless.
